Transaction 32f588b31f8a4af20a28436e4cb0f476bd5de7e68f48c917d9b793ad0abf1126

2 Input
2 Outputs
  • 32f588b31f8a4af20a28436e4cb0f476bd5de7e68f48c917d9b793ad0abf1126:0
  • value  18546184
    address  1ESWqWZDd8tYGos9oXvyg2AtSxASyuVtcU
  • 32f588b31f8a4af20a28436e4cb0f476bd5de7e68f48c917d9b793ad0abf1126:1
  • value  12553820
    address  1Ji4Gfyw6YGoRrWLPQMwtNyQdLhM6bcbmb